Girl Loses Foot in Landmine Blast Along LoC in Uri

Date:

Zaffer Iqbal

Uri, Dec 22 : A 20-year-old girl has lost her foot in a landmine blast along Line of Control in Hathlanga village in Uri on Wednesday afternoon, officials and reports said.

Reports reaching GNS said that a girl identified as Masooma Bano, 20, daughter of Juma Chachi lost her left foot injury in a landmine blast. The girl was reportedly grazing a sheep herd close to her home.

A health official told GNS that they received a girl at SDH hospital with severe leg injury even as her left foot was cut off. “After assessing her condition, she was referred to GMC Baramulla for preferential treatment”, the official said. (GNS)
